Output de95acc753af2386465271caaff9c4a877327e3e4d54ce5c52a97f355584b238:0

value
63666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c859e9e77f7e66ab3daef42694453f225301580 OP_EQUAL
address
35kRj37Yhy5CzDPhcmHrJM96AEA32tgW5z
transaction
de95acc753af2386465271caaff9c4a877327e3e4d54ce5c52a97f355584b238